From left to right: Mme. Lily Schreyer; Peter Carter, editor of The Manitoulin Expositor; His Excellency Governor General Ed Schreyer; R.L. McCutcheon, publisher of The Manitoulin Expositor; former Governor General Roland Michener.

The Expositor was honoured for its news and editorial coverage of Manitoulin Island's suicide rate which was nearly double the national average. The newspaper was credited with prompting action to link the island to an emergency telephone help line in Sudbury.

The Michener Award for meritorious and disinterested public service in journalism is the only Canadian journalism award bearing the name of a governor general and it differs from most such awards in that it goes to the organization, not to individuals.
